XML 113 R100.htm IDEA: XBRL DOCUMENT v3.24.0.1
Derivatives and hedging activities - Cumulative Basis Adjustment for Fair Value Hedges (Details) - USD ($)
$ in Thousands
Dec. 31, 2023
Dec. 31, 2022
Derivatives, Fair Value    
Amortized Amount of the Hedged Assets/(Liabilities) $ 19,833 $ 22,196
Hedged Asset, Statement of Financial Position [Extensible Enumeration] Available-for-sale Securities, Debt Securities  
Fair value hedges | Derivatives designated as hedging instruments    
Derivatives, Fair Value    
Amortized Amount of the Hedged Assets/(Liabilities) $ 194,035  
Cumulative Amount of Fair Value Hedging Adjustment Included in the Carrying Amount of the Hedged Assets/(Liabilities) 1,333  
Fair value hedges | Derivatives designated as hedging instruments | Interest rate swaps    
Derivatives, Fair Value    
Amortized Amount of the Hedged Assets/(Liabilities) $ 143,573  
Derivative Asset, Statement of Financial Position [Extensible Enumeration] Available-for-sale Securities, Debt Securities Available-for-sale Securities, Debt Securities
Cumulative Amount of Fair Value Hedging Adjustment Included in the Carrying Amount of the Hedged Assets/(Liabilities) $ 871  
Amortized Cost Basis Amount of the Hedged Assets 143,600  
Amounts of designated hedged items 100,000  
Fair value hedges | Derivatives designated as hedging instruments | Fixed Rate Loans    
Derivatives, Fair Value    
Amortized Amount of the Hedged Assets/(Liabilities) 50,462  
Cumulative Amount of Fair Value Hedging Adjustment Included in the Carrying Amount of the Hedged Assets/(Liabilities) 462  
Hedged Asset, carrying value $ 50,000